About telephone number +12402976630

Telephone number +12402976630 has a country code of 1, which indicates that it is from the North American Numbering Plan (NANP) area. The area code (240) indicates that the number covers the State of Maryland, USA and the Exchange Code (297) indicates that the number covers the town or city of Washington. This Exchange code was originally designated for Landline usage and the original service provider was "LEVEL 3 COMMUNICATIONS, LLC - MD".

Telephone number +12402976630 is being used as part of an Advance Fee Fraud Scam by someone claiming to be "Jeffrey Hawkins" from IC3 Internet Crimes Compensation Center and using the email address ic3.iccc@usa.com. The telephone number in included in the following Advance Fee Fraud email that is being sent to victims:
Attention

I'm sorry this was the only way to reach you.

This notification is regarding your overdue payment that has been reviewed for payment.I tried getting in touch with you earlier to attend to this matter but all effort failed.

You need to stop contacting those fraudsters if you don't want to end up broke and frustrated.Why will they continue to deceive you in circles for unnecessary payment demands? Money does not grow on trees.

The ICCC is now in charge of your payment for security reasons, and i have been instructed to report ANYBODY attempting to divert your payment.

There is no more room for nonsense...anybody attempting to divert your payment this time will be prosecuted.

I strongly advise you get in contact with me immediately via Call now or Text below to put an end to this and get you paid physical cash not empty promises.

CFO. Jeffrey Hawkins
IC3 Internet Crimes Compensation Center.
Email: ic3.iccc@usa.com
Tel/Fax: +1 240 297 6630
The email was sent from the email address "IC3 Internet Crimes Compensation Center <ic3_iccc@usa.com>", with the Reply-to address "ic3.iccc@usa.com" and the subject "Attn.Ic3".

The email is a classic example of an Advance Fee Fraud Scam with promises of a large sum of money. Anyone responding to it will be told that there is a fee/tax/insurance payment to be paid to receive the money. This will be followed by payment after payment until the victim runs out of money or realises that they are being scammed.
